Wes Moore is the 63rd Governor of the state of Maryland. He is Maryland's first Black Governor in the state's 246-year history, and is just the third African American to serve as a state governor in the country. Moore's election marks a significant milestone in the state's political landscape, as he is breaking barriers and paving the way for future generations.

Governor Moore's journey to the highest office in Maryland began with his dedication to public service and his commitment to addressing issues of social justice and inequality. As a former Rhodes Scholar, Army officer, and successful author, Moore brings a diverse range of experiences and perspectives to his role as the state's chief executive.
